Okay well, sometimes I look at code and I think "good start" and then sometimes I feel like Simon Cowell ... and ask them to start over. So to determine where I stand with the Diaspora code, allow me to quote the article:
This basic pattern was repeated several times in Diaspora’s code base: security-sensitive actions on the server used the params hash to identify pieces of data they were to operate on, without checking that the logged in user was actually authorized to view or operate on that data. For example, if you were logged in to a Diaspora seed and knew the ID of any photo on the server, changing the URL of any destroy action from the ID of a photo you own to an ID of any other photo would let you delete that second photo. Rails makes exploits like this child’s play, since URLs to actions are trivially easy to guess and object IDs “leak” all over the place. Do not assume than an object ID is private.

Security is part of the design, not the implementation.
Most developers still haven't learned that security isn't something you check for at various access points in the code: it is something you build directly into the business layer. For example, your code should not have a method like this anywhere:
public DeletePicture(int pictureID)
The method should be:
public DeletePicture(SecurityCredentials user, int pictureID)
This way it is impossible for your web to accidentally call DeletePicture() without checking for security. The security check is built-in to the lower-level and there is nothing you can do about it. Having worked on secure web services before, I realize I did not do this in my design, which was great for making simple tools, but it meant that all user-facing code had to have checks for security loopholes. The basic thing is that any software project, FOSS or not, depends on competent software engineers for proper application design, testing, and so forth. Security issues are preventable, but you need engineers, not developers, to do the design and address how authentication/authorization needs to be handled. This is true regardless of development methodology (the role of an engineer is arguably different when doing something like extreme programming but I am not at all convinced that it goes away).
If you don't really understand security, don't try to write secure software all by yourself. FOSS does well when it comes to peer review. Use that. Have experts tell you what you are doing wrong. I know I have learned a lot over the years from such experts and am now much better at that area than I used to be. Think of it like an apprenticeship. For a FOSS project, opening the code early is a good idea. Get review before the problems become pernicious and very difficult to fix. This mistake will probably cost the Diaspora team at least few months in release time, and we can all hope it is fixed properly without meeting the fate of Duke Nukem Forever.
What went wrong is simple: You have a few young (and hence experienced) hotshot (i.e. technically competent) programmers working on a major project without expert feedback using the latest fad technologies (rails, etc). Things get missed. The results are impressive but so are the failures, and by the time the problems are noticed, fixing them is difficult and expensive in terms of time and money.
It's exactly like laying copper pipe, or putting in wiring, except that instead of three times as long, it takes 10x as long or longer to fix after the fact. If you don't know what you are doing, get supervised by someone who does. Again, that's a real strength of FOSS, but it takes an openness that all too many projects lack.
In my experience with insecure FOSS projects, the problem is usually a combination of secrecy and unwillingness to accept input at critical stages. This is true, for example, with SQL-Ledger which keeps development versions secret and where the developer is unwilling to generally accept code contributions or even development feedback from others. Secure projects (like PostgreSQL) generally have more open development processes and yet retain control by a small meritocratic committee.

I'm going to chime in here with a different view.
I used to recommend SQL-Ledger to customers of mine. I didn't put it through a detailed security review. I didn't realize how bad it was. I had only really been writing web apps for about a year and while I had though a lot about security I didn't trust my own conclusions much yet (I still don't trust myself where I don't have to).
Then I discovered a major security hole in the program, of the sort described here. The program asked for authorization and then inadequately checked for it. It was trivial to forge credentials to bypass controls. Bad..... I went to the developer figuring he'd understand and fix it. Of course little did I know the developer was out of his league or else the problem wouldn't have occurred. The problem didn't get fixed.
After some time of trying unsuccessfully to get the problem fixed (for a year, btw), and getting back at least one totally inadequate fix, I complained to a few trusted development friends and pretty quickly one of them introduced a few others to me and we got LedgerSMB started.
So we initially decided to try to retrofit the SQL-Ledger codebase with security measures. We gave up after a year and three major releases, opting instead for a block-by-block rewrite because the obvious issues were only the tip of the iceburg. Removing SQL injection vulnerabilities alone took 2 months (and we missed only one out of thousands of putative vulnerabilities).
I think this sort of experience here has real value to this discussion. The problems are essentially the same: inadequate checks for authorization, inadequate checks for code injection, and the like. These are often VERY intrusive to fix, and very time consuming to audit for. The code was also poorly structured, and the db design bordered on unusable (a lot of the code relied on ambiguous foreign key relationships).
If these sorts of errors are being made here, then my past experience tells me that this project will never be safe to use. It's a great proof of concept. Now they need to start over, do real security design, and scrap their current release schedule (push things out maybe a year). And they need to ensure they get REAL security experts on their team, i.e. people who review the code and dress down developers who do stupid things. And they need to keep things open from the start of the rewrite so suggestions come in before it's too late to fix them.
However if they don't do this, the project will never amount to anything.

The first clue is that they intended to release a secure distributed social networking platform and that the first thing they released publicly was an application, not documentation of the security model and federation protocol.
If you had a good design for the security model and federation protocol, you can implement an application leveraging using any usable tools (and Rails, used correctly, would probably be quite serviceable in this regard.)
But you probably aren't going to just stumble into a secure distributed application if you don't start with a solid foundation, no matter what platform you use.
